Post

The Evolution of XSS Attacks: How React Failed to Eliminate JavaScript Injection Threats

The Evolution of XSS Attacks: How React Failed to Eliminate JavaScript Injection Threats

TL;DR

  • React, though designed to mitigate XSS attacks, has not entirely eliminated the threat.
  • Attackers have developed new injection techniques targeting prototype pollution and AI-generated code.
  • A comprehensive 47-page guide is available for framework-specific defenses.

The Evolution of XSS Attacks: How React Failed to Eliminate JavaScript Injection Threats

React, a popular JavaScript library, was initially hailed for its ability to mitigate Cross-Site Scripting (XSS) attacks. However, in 2025, developers face a different reality: attackers have evolved their injection techniques to bypass even the most robust frameworks. These new methods exploit vulnerabilities such as prototype pollution and AI-generated code, rendering many security measures ineffective.

Understanding the Threat

JavaScript’s dominance on the web has made it a prime target for cyber threats. Despite React’s efforts to bolster security, attackers continue to find ways to inject malicious code. This resurgence in XSS attacks underscores the need for continuous vigilance and updated defensive strategies.

New Injection Techniques

Attackers have developed sophisticated techniques to exploit modern web applications. These include:

  • Prototype Pollution: Manipulating JavaScript prototype chains to inject malicious code.
  • AI-Generated Code Exploits: Leveraging AI to generate code that can bypass traditional security checks.

Framework-Specific Defenses

To combat these evolving threats, a comprehensive 47-page guide has been compiled. This resource offers detailed, framework-specific defenses to help developers secure their applications effectively.

For more details, visit the full article: source

Conclusion

The battle against XSS attacks is far from over. As attackers continue to innovate, developers must stay informed and adapt their security strategies. The provided guide is an invaluable resource for those seeking to fortify their applications against these emerging threats.

Additional Resources

For further insights, check:

This post is licensed under CC BY 4.0 by the author.